Burns Itself Out. Attempts
were made to sink the ship by boring holes in the hull, but she suddenly listed and there was nothing else to do un- der the circumstances but to let the fire burn itself out. No one could be induced to go aboard her for some time for fear that there was more oil and further explo- sions would ensue.
The amount of the damage is yet unknown. The "Koyo Maru" was bought by Japanese interests only three days ago. She is of 10,000 tons gross and was sold for Yen 700,000. The detailed tables of transits during the last two scal years show that, in 1925-26,. 6,197 ships went through the canal, as com- pared with 4,678 in 1924-25. The cargo tonnage was in excess of the registered net tonnage of of these ships, the cargo transited in 1925-26 being 26,037,448 and, in 1924-25, 29,968,448 tons." The figures show a flat increase in number of transits, net tonnage and cargo tonnage for each month over the corresponding month in the previous year:
Greatest Traffic in History. The report notes that "in the first six months of 1926 the cargo, tonnage through the canal was the greatest in any six months in the canal's history regardless of the nature of the cargo, which as noted above, however, recorded an increase of oil shipments. cargo tonnage in these six months was. 13,881,860 tons.
